Match Preview
Liverpool host Manchester City at Anfield in a fixture that almost always feels like a season-defining checkpoint. Even when both teams arrive with different storylines, the match tends to deliver the same ingredients: aggressive pressing, tactical adjustments every 15 minutes, and a few moments of quality that decide everything.
Liverpool’s best version is built on intensity. When they win the ball high and attack quickly, they can overwhelm any opponent. At Anfield, that first wave matters. If Liverpool turn early pressure into shots, corners, and chaos in the box, City can be forced into defending deeper than they prefer.
Manchester City, however, are masters at slowing games down. They recycle possession, pull teams out of shape, and wait for one clean opening rather than forcing low-quality chances. The key for City is escaping Liverpool’s press. If they break the first line and get midfield control, City can pin Liverpool back and keep the crowd quieter than usual.
Game-state will be massive. The first goal changes the entire match plan. If Liverpool score first, Anfield becomes a weapon. If City score first, they can dictate tempo and force Liverpool into riskier decisions. Expect a high-level tactical duel with very fine margins.
